#include <Cluster1DCleaner.h>
Public Member Functions | |
Cluster1DCleaner (const float zoffset, bool useErr) | |
std::vector< Cluster1D< T > > | clusters (const std::vector< Cluster1D< T > > &) |
std::vector< Cluster1D< T > > | discardedCluster1Ds () const |
Private Member Functions | |
float | average (const std::vector< Cluster1D< T > > &) |
void | cleanCluster1Ds (const std::vector< Cluster1D< T > > &) |
Private Attributes | |
std::vector< Cluster1D< T > > | theCleanedCluster1Ds |
std::vector< Cluster1D< T > > | theDiscardedCluster1Ds |
bool | theUseError |
float | theZOffSet |
Definition at line 13 of file Cluster1DCleaner.h.
|
inline |
Definition at line 17 of file Cluster1DCleaner.h.
References Cluster1DCleaner< T >::clusters(), Cluster1DCleaner< T >::theCleanedCluster1Ds, and Cluster1DCleaner< T >::theDiscardedCluster1Ds.
|
private |
Definition at line 88 of file Cluster1DCleaner.h.
References mathSSE::sqrt().
Referenced by average.Average::__str__(), Cluster1DCleaner< T >::cleanCluster1Ds(), and Cluster1DCleaner< T >::discardedCluster1Ds().
|
private |
Definition at line 59 of file Cluster1DCleaner.h.
References Cluster1DCleaner< T >::average(), listHistos::discr, Cluster1DCleaner< T >::theCleanedCluster1Ds, Cluster1DCleaner< T >::theDiscardedCluster1Ds, Cluster1DCleaner< T >::theUseError, and Cluster1DCleaner< T >::theZOffSet.
Referenced by Cluster1DCleaner< T >::clusters(), and Cluster1DCleaner< T >::discardedCluster1Ds().
std::vector< Cluster1D< T > > Cluster1DCleaner< T >::clusters | ( | const std::vector< Cluster1D< T > > & | _clust | ) |
Definition at line 50 of file Cluster1DCleaner.h.
References Cluster1DCleaner< T >::cleanCluster1Ds(), and Cluster1DCleaner< T >::theCleanedCluster1Ds.
Referenced by Cluster1DCleaner< T >::Cluster1DCleaner().
|
inline |
Definition at line 30 of file Cluster1DCleaner.h.
References Cluster1DCleaner< T >::average(), Cluster1DCleaner< T >::cleanCluster1Ds(), and Cluster1DCleaner< T >::theDiscardedCluster1Ds.
|
private |
Definition at line 38 of file Cluster1DCleaner.h.
Referenced by Cluster1DCleaner< T >::cleanCluster1Ds(), Cluster1DCleaner< T >::Cluster1DCleaner(), and Cluster1DCleaner< T >::clusters().
|
private |
Definition at line 39 of file Cluster1DCleaner.h.
Referenced by Cluster1DCleaner< T >::cleanCluster1Ds(), Cluster1DCleaner< T >::Cluster1DCleaner(), and Cluster1DCleaner< T >::discardedCluster1Ds().
|
private |
Definition at line 41 of file Cluster1DCleaner.h.
Referenced by Cluster1DCleaner< T >::cleanCluster1Ds().
|
private |
Definition at line 40 of file Cluster1DCleaner.h.
Referenced by Cluster1DCleaner< T >::cleanCluster1Ds().